Welcome to the Cadenza. Puddle lamps on the underside of the rear view mirrors automatically light up when the car detects the smart key approaching. When the smart key unlock button is activated, the exterior lamps illuminate for 15 seconds, the interior lamps for 30 seconds. 2013 KIA Cadenza power comes courtesy of a new Lambda II 3.5 litre engine, providing improved powertrain performance. Durability is built in, an essential when driving in high temperature climates. Other advantages include reduced vibration, low noise when idling and accelerating, an eco oil filter that lowers maintenance costs, and reduced overall weight to enhance fuel economy. Even before you start the engine, the sporty overtones are clear. There’s no need to turn a key, just push the button. Starting and stopping the ignition become an exercise in convenience. As befits a luxury sedan, the Cadenza’s accelerator pedal is designed for maximum comfort by allowing your foot and ankle to move in the same trajectory as the pedal itself. Next generation Kia technology reduces the number of transmission parts, while lowered weight provides superior performance and fuel economy. Lambda II 3.5L gasoline engine: A fuel efficient, lightweight unit generating a maximum 290 ps at 6600 rpm. Composed of an aluminium cylinder block, Cadenza’s powerful engine features dual continuously variable valve timing, a silent timing chain system to minimise noise, and a variable intake system to maximise efficiency.
